Baby Audio has announced the release of a major update to its analog-style drum synth designed to help users craft deep electronic drums with authentic circuit-modeling and expansive sound design possibilities.
Version 1.1 of Tekno is a comprehensive update with a long list of enhancements including the most requested feature—an onboard sequencer.
Tekno’s new sequencer view gives producers an inspiring beat creation environment directly inside the plugin. With dedicated lanes for all 18 voices and up to 32 steps per lane, the sequencer offers creative features like smart randomization, shortenable lanes for polyrhythms, speed multipliers and hit chance.
Other major improvements sourced directly from user feedback include global undo/redo, full kit sample export and 4 available choke groups.
Changes in Tekno v1.1
- New Sequencer mode.
- New choke groups feature.
- Freely assignable MIDI mappings.
- New global undo/redo option.
- Per-voice Humanize option.
- Full kit sample export.
- Per-voice randomization lock.
- Copy and paste equivalent voices (Tom L&H, Conga L&H).
- Dedicated reverb bus in multi-output mode.
- Fixes implemented for all known bugs.
